Fire is disastrous and can change how your life will look like afterwards completely. The restoration, however, does not have to be difficult and tedious. By knowing where you will begin and what you are supposed to do once there is an inferno outbreak can make your recovery process much easier. Smoke from the inferno and water used by the extinguishing machines are the main headaches and knowing how you can respond to such problems can enhance quick Mesa AZ fire Damage restoration.

The confusion that attacks homeowners during such incidents make them do crazy things like rushing in to salvage their valuables. This is a risky exercise considering that ceiling could fall on you when trying to save human beings or properties. Never go any close to a burning house. Watch from a distant and wait for the firefighting experts to stop it and see if anything will have been salvaged.

Access to the house where fire has just stopped should be done after experts have given it a green light. Many incidents have been experienced where people rushed in to see what has remained to save it or steal it from the homeowners only to die after ceilings or walls collapsed on the. Safeguard your family and neighbors from getting injured or losing lives by allowing them in after the approval of the experts.

After you are given permission to go into the premises, start salvaging any intact paperwork or records such as, passports, birth certificates, and all the identifiable documents. Such items are thrown away or damaged when restoration process is ongoing and could add up to your losses. The documents will be essential in making compensation claims from the insurance and might save you headaches that occur when reapplying for them.

The water from the extinguishing machines is at high pressure and may also cause some damages to the property. Apart from damaging documents, it makes the environment habitable for molds. If the surfaces and items in the house are not dried properly, mold will grow and this could be endangering to the house occupants. Dry furniture, clothes, and beddings by keeping them out on sunny grounds for days until they have no any moisture left on them.

Smoke from the raging fires makes all the utensils be covered by suit whereby homeowners might even think of throwing them away. The carpets that are burnt out and damaged floors should be attended to before bringing in new furniture. Use bleaching soaps and detergents in the cleanup process to ensure no germs are left on the floor or the dishes.

Most people would start throwing away damaged furniture or items forgetting that these items will support your insurance claim. Put them somewhere safe and take snapshots before removing them from their initial position in the house. Any dispute that concerns the damage extent by the insurance company can be resolved using the photographs taken after the inferno.

Ever wondered what happens when your dollars get burnt in a house during the accident. The money is not lost altogether as long as you will have some of its pieces. Take them to the Federal Reserve where you shall be reimbursed with new notes for the same value.
